In a video report published on December 30, 2025, *The New York Times* examines the "Trump Effect" on global elections. According to Canada bureau chief Matina Stevis-Gridneff, President Trump has become a recurring theme in political races worldwide. The video, produced by Stevis-Gridneff and several colleagues, analyzes election results from various countries. The report suggests that Trump's influence, or the discussion surrounding him, is impacting political discourse and outcomes beyond the United States. The video aims to provide viewers with a rundown of specific instances where the "Trump Effect" has been observed in global elections.
